Researching Potential Real Estate Agents
Ask for Recommendations
When searching for a real-estate agent, you should ask for recommendations. This can come from friends, relatives, or coworkers who have just bought or recently sold a property. Here are a few tips on how you can create a list with potential agents:
1. Start by reaching out to your inner circle and asking for their recommendations. Referrals by word of mouth are often the most reliable source for finding a trustworthy agent.
2. Online resources, such as real estate sites, forums, and social networking platforms, can be used to gather recommendations from an even wider network.
3. Attend open houses and observe how the agent interacts. Consider adding the agent to your list if their professionalism and expertise impresses you.
4. Check online reviews & ratings on real estate brokers in your area. Websites like Zillow, Realtor.com, and Yelp can provide valuable feedback from previous clients.
5. Ask for recommendations from local real estate offices. They can provide you with valuable insight into which agents are the most experienced in your locality.
6. Interview multiple agents from your list and ask them about their experience, marketing strategies, real estate agents in rancho cucamonga and track record of successful transactions. This will help you determine who is the best fit for your specific needs.
7. Consider factors like communication style or availability when choosing a realty agent. You want a real estate agent who is easy-going and will keep you updated throughout the entire buying or selling process.
Follow these steps to create a comprehensive real estate agent list and find the best match for your real estate goals.

Recent Sales in Your Area
View Recent Sales in Your Area
Realtors can give you information on recent sales to help you determine your home’s market value. You can estimate the value of your home by looking at similar properties that have sold recently.
Realtors will have access to MLS, which is a database of up-to-date data on homes sold within your neighborhood. They can analyze market trends to help you price your house competitively.
examining recent sales in your region will also give you an idea of how quickly houses are selling, and what features are the most attractive to buyers. This information can help make informed decisions on when to list your house and how you should stage it to maximize its appeal.
It can be very helpful to work with a real estate agent that has experience in the local market when it comes time to price your home. They can provide you with an analysis of recent sales and help you determine a realistic price to attract buyers.
Overall, examining recent sales in your locality is a crucial step in the process of selling a home. This can help you gain a better grasp of the current conditions in the market and make informed pricing decisions for your home.

Inquire About Their Marketing Strategies
It is important that you understand the different marketing strategies used by real estate agents to promote their properties and attract potential clients. The agent’s presence on the internet is a key factor to consider. A strong strategy for online marketing can include listing real estate listings on popular sites, using social networks to promote listings, or creating virtual tours and videos of properties.
Another important aspect of a real estate agent’s marketing strategy is their networking capabilities. A successful real estate agent should have an extensive network of potential buyers and other industry professionals they can tap to promote properties. A real estate agent can increase their reach through networking events and open houses.
In addition, traditional marketing techniques such as advertising on print publications, sending direct mailers, or using signage can be effective at reaching potential buyers. Discuss with the agent how these traditional methods will be used in conjunction with their internet and networking strategies.
When asking about a realty agent’s marketing strategy, it is important that they have a comprehensive marketing plan that combines online, traditional marketing, and networking to effectively market properties and attract buyers.

Sign an agreement with the Real Estate Agent of Your Choice
Consider your options carefully before choosing an agent. Ask friends, family or colleagues who recently bought or sold property for recommendations and start researching the different agents in your locality.
Once you’ve compiled a short list of agents to interview, set up interviews to learn more about their experience, communication styles, and approach to transactions. Ask the agent about their track record, the type of properties that they specialize in and how they can assist you with your real estate goals.
After meeting several agents, select the one with whom you feel most comfortable and who you think will best represent your interest. Once you make your decision, you should sign an agreement to formalize your relationship with the agent.
The agreement will outline the details of your partnership. These include the agent’s duties, the duration and any commissions or fees that are to be paid. Make sure to read the agreement carefully and ask for clarification on any points that you do not understand.
By signing a contract with your chosen agent, you take an important first step to successfully buy or sell a property. A good agent can guide you through the entire process, negotiate in your favor, and help you reach the best possible result. Communication and trust will be key to this partnership. Keep the lines of communication wide open and make sure you provide your agent with the necessary information.
